Output 3962c9f04e58eac25c2d414f0ac97c16813ab54df7e2d5891717720c9252533d:2

value
311132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34bcb6ed2e3a406dd2ff3a8107b3c232b7d4d487 OP_EQUAL
address
36Vs8drRa2TxVBMdWHSzHYYqpU1hEXgdwV
transaction
3962c9f04e58eac25c2d414f0ac97c16813ab54df7e2d5891717720c9252533d
confirmations
172762
spent
true